Today, Emmy-winning and Golden Globe nominated standup comedian AMY SCHUMER announced her first major tour in over 4 years. Amy Schumer's Whore Tour begins this August and is making a stop in Denver, CO at Paramount Theatre on Sat, August 27 at 7pm and Sun, August 28 at 6pm and 8:30pm.
Rachel Zegler has been invited to present at the Oscars. The 20-year-old is currently in London filming Disney's upcoming live-action remake of Snow White. Efforts are currently being made to rearrange the film's production schedule will be rearranged so Zegler can attend the ceremony. West Side Story is nominated for seven awards.

The Billie Holiday Theatre has announced the return of its monologue showcase series - 50in50 – with a special fifth anniversary edition of the show - 50in50: Shattering the Glass Ceiling. For this year’s show, 50 original monologues were selected from women of African descent from across the globe and will be read by 50 women actors.
